Lupos Global has a requirement for a Quality Manager. Our client is a large MRO and one of the world’s leading providers of technical solutions to airlines and based in Malta.

 

Summary:

This position reports to the Group Head Quality of the Company, whilst working closely with the Group’s Quality department. The Quality is responsible for supporting the Quality and Safety Management System and for ensuring that it continues to comply with regulatory requirements and to meet the needs of the business.

 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

· Plans and ensures an effective Quality Management System within Aircraft Maintenance in accordance with relevant requirements published by appropriate National Aviation authorities and / or other international standards, e.g. EN 9110, ISO 9001

· Prepares an annual audit plan for aircraft maintenance and supports the coordination of the group audit plan

· Checks the implementation of the quality management system through quality audits according to the audit plan and supports business units in the implementation of a close loop process for quality related findings (audits, occurrences) in developing action plans from findings

· Supports continuous improvement process with the focus on aircraft maintenance aiming for failure costs reduction and process/procedure improvements

· Liaises with customer, authorities, suppliers and all Business Units with the focus on aircraft maintenance on quality matters

· Supports and facilitates the customer’s audit management in close cooperation with the Quality Services Department in Zurich

· Provides advice regarding quality and safety system themes and training within aircraft maintenance to the Malta operation

· Follows operational risk management and supports the results for implementation

· Engages in the interpretation of the aviation and international standards to update audit questionnaire and support the business units

· Monitors the aircraft maintenance quality and safety key elements and engages in the initiating of required corrective and preventive actions

· Statistically analyses and reports findings to show areas of concentrated risks and concerns;

· Tracks the progress of essential quality and safety criteria and ensure on-going communication with aircraft maintenance managers for quality and safety issues in their areas

· Escalates shortfalls and deviations at earliest possible stage

· Challenges and follows up on corrective actions closed (effectiveness and risk reduction)

· Engages in the implementation of SMS and continuous development of a safety culture within all aircraft maintenance sites

· Supports and facilitates quality related training needs analysis within the company

· Engages in quality and safety oversights (e.g. inspectors, certifying staff) within aircraft maintenance sites and departments independent of organizational reporting line

· Engages in the coordination of stamps and supports the Training Manager and Training Coordinators in the issuing of company authorization and permissions

· Engage in any other task commensurate with the role.

 

Profile:

The ideal candidate should possess:

· A minimum of 5 years of experience in the aviation maintenance industry

· Extensive knowledge of aviation regulations (EASA Part 145, Part 147, Part 66, Part 21, Part M, 14 CFR 145 and international standards (EN9110, ISO)

· Experience as an auditor in an aircraft/component/engine maintenance organization

· Has knowledge of EN9110 standards
